État de la populationTexte officiel évaluation IUCNExpert
There is no information available on the population size of this species, and it has not been reported again after its discovery. The population trend is suspected decreasing due to continuous disturbances in nearby habitat.

Description complète des menacesTexte détaillé évaluation IUCNExpert
The type locality of Biermannia arunachalensis is protected within the Orchid Research Centre, Tipi. However, a wider distribution outside of the Research Centre is possible, and the adjacent habitats are facing numerous threats such as the expansion of human settlements, climate change, air pollution from nearby factories, logging and habitat destruction.

Mesures de conservation recommandéesStratégies de conservation IUCNExpert
All orchid species are included under Appendix II of the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species of Wild Fauna and Flora (CITES). The Government of India has banned the export for commercial purposes of all wild-taken specimens of species included in Appendices I, II and III, except cultivated varieties of plant species included in Appendices I and II accompanied by a CITES Comparable Certificate issued by the competent authorities of India (CITES Notif. No. 2018/031). The type locality is well protected within the Orchid Research Centre under the Department of Environment and Forests, Government of Arunachal Pradesh, but no live specimens have been found at the type locality.
Research is required to confirm the current distribution and population size of this species in the area. The species is not in ex situ conservation.
